Sending Broadcast Emails:
|
|
|
 |
|
- Go to www.active.com/explorer
- Type in your username and password, click log in
- When the page refreshes go to the “Select Listing ->” drop down bar located in the top left – pull the bar down to select which listing you would like to access.
- Once you have selected a listing you will see a set of yellow folders on the left hand side of the page; go to Registration Tools
- Go to the Broadcast Email folder
- Click “New Mailing” button
- Click on the top button entitled “Edit Filters”
- A box will appear with all of your listings (events) listed (this will include all your present & past events)
- The box will list the names of your listings and then indented below that is that specific listing’s registration categories
- Highlight the listing names that you want to include in the email
- To select multiple categories: hold down the “control” button and click on the multiple listings that you want to highlight. Highlighting the listing names will automatically include the registration categories listed below each listing
- Once you have highlighted the listings you want to include in your email click the “search” button in the bottom right hand corner
- Click the “continue” button
- On this final page, fill out the rest of the information (ie: the sender’s email address, the email title & email message)
- Then click “Save and Send” button

A Race Within a Race
Bob Seagren – Long Beach International City Bank Marathon
|
|
|
|
 |
|
|
International City Racing was founded in 2001 in an effort to acquire the rights to the foundering Long Beach Marathon. While the event had quite a storied history (the first race having been run in 1982), the event was on the verge of going away. Bob Seagren, the company CEO (who happens to be an Olympic Champion winning the Gold Medal in the 1968 Mexico City Olympics in the Pole Vault) helped restore some sense of trust for the event.
The first few years were challenging, but ICR always moved forward with strategic steps to encourage more race and community participation. When the current title sponsor became involved in 2002 (International City Bank), they wanted to encourage some of the key Departments from the City of Long Beach to become involved in the event. Thus was born the Police vs. Fire 5K Challenge.
In its 7th year, the event is subset of the 5K that is hosted as one of the marathon events. The Long Beach Police Department and the Long Beach Fire Department have set up this battle for bragging rights and to raise funds for their team’s charity. Anyone can register for the Police vs. Fire 5K Challenge. A portion of each registration is donated back to the respective charities: the LBPOA Memorial Widows Emergency & Scholarship Trust Fund and the Friends of Long Beach Firefighters. As for competition, the top 10 sworn Police and Firefighters times are counted and the winning team is awarded a perpetual trophy at our Finish Line Festival. “It’s worked out great and is very competitive for the annual bragging rights,” said Seagren. It’s been one of many steps we’ve taken to help us build up the event to the 18,000 to 20,000 participants expected to compete in 2008.”
